What Elderflower does

You enter a recipient’s mobile number, the words you want them to receive, and the times and days each message should go out. Elderflower sends those messages by SMS on that schedule, from a number the recipient can save as a contact under a name you choose.

We record the delivery status each mobile carrier reports back and show it to you. Delivery status means a message reached the recipient’s handset. It does not mean they read it, and it does not mean they did what the message suggested. We will never present it as if it did.

The recipient is never required to reply to anything after their initial confirmation. Elderflower does not ask them questions, does not score their answers, and does not report their behaviour to you.

The recipient is always in control

The recipient may reply STOP to any message and all messages end immediately. They may reply START to resume, and HELP for support information. These controls belong to them, work without reference to you, and cannot be disabled from your account. If they opt out, we will tell you that messages have stopped — we will not tell you to talk them out of it.

Delivery is best effort

Text messages travel across mobile networks we do not own. Messages can be delayed, filtered, blocked, or lost — because a phone is off, out of coverage, out of storage, or because a carrier decided so. We cannot guarantee that any individual message is delivered, or delivered at an exact minute.

Mobile carriers are not liable for delayed or undelivered messages. Please do not build a plan around Elderflower where a single missed message would be harmful.
